
OpenAI's ChatGPT Work aims to automate complex, hours-long enterprise tasks with GPT-5.6
Published by AINave Editorial • Reviewed by Ramit
OpenAI has launched ChatGPT Work, an AI agent designed to autonomously execute complex, hours-long tasks across connected applications, files, and web tools. Powered by GPT-5.6 and Codex, the agent marks a shift from prompt-based responses to persistent, goal-driven automation for enterprise users.
What happened
ChatGPT Work is a new mode within ChatGPT that performs actions autonomously across user's connected apps, files, web tools, desktops, and recurring workflows. It can create spreadsheets, slide presentations, documents, dashboards, web applications, and more from a single prompt. The agent is powered by GPT-5.6, OpenAI's latest frontier model, which incorporates the full Codex experience for multistep execution with a coding element.
GPT-5.6 comes in three variants: Sol (advanced reasoning and coding), Terra (enterprise workloads), and Luna (high-volume, low-cost applications). OpenAI CEO Sam Altman reported a 54% improvement in token efficiency over GPT-5.5 for agentic coding tasks, which could reduce costs for automated software development.
ChatGPT Work is initially available to Pro, Enterprise, and Edu subscribers, with Pro and Business tier access coming in the following days. The updated ChatGPT desktop app (Windows and Mac) now integrates Chat, Codex, and Work into a single service available across all plans, including free users.
Why AI builders should care
For teams building AI products and workflows, ChatGPT Work signals a shift toward persistent, agent-driven automation with enterprise-grade governance. OpenAI provides enterprise controls to manage browser use, plugins, connected tools, and sensitive actions, including preauthorization and usage limits. This makes the agent suitable for regulated environments.
Real-world beta usage at Nvidia, Zapier, RingCentral, and Virgin Atlantic demonstrates enterprise appetite for agent-based automation. Use cases included reviewing thousands of sales leads, checking product launch readiness across Jira and go-to-market plans, comparing passenger experiences, and automating event preparation for Nvidia GTC 2026.
Practical implications
ChatGPT Work decomposes larger goals into smaller tasks and works on them over extended timeframes, asking for human approval before sensitive actions. It supports plugins for Slack, Microsoft Teams, Gmail, Google Drive, Salesforce, SharePoint, calendars, project tracking, and more. Users invoke specific apps by typing "@" and the plugin name.
OpenAI also debuted Sites (public beta for Plus, Pro, Business, Enterprise), which transforms work materials into shareable, interactive websites or web apps such as internal portals, dashboards, and prototypes. ChatGPT can test these sites and update them automatically when source information changes.
The ChatGPT app now includes an integrated browser with Computer Use functionality for internet context and navigation across Google Workspace and Microsoft 365. The Chrome extension is enhanced to position ChatGPT in the sidebar.
Caveats
Claims about long-running task autonomy come from company communications and demonstrations. Real-world reliability, safety approvals, and cost will vary by deployment and governance. The 54% token efficiency improvement and pricing implications are reported figures that may depend on usage patterns and enterprise arrangements. GPT-5.6 underwent a collaborative safety review with U.S. government officials before public release, which may affect future update cadence.
